This was my third berget and every single year I've had to deal with:

1) Dead guys not wearing rags -> had to give up position by firing at ghosts
2) Dead red guys wearing red rags -> difficult to see if they're really down -> have sometimes hit dead people with rags
3) Dead guys moving in same group with living guys and/or unmarked dead guys -> you choose between either firing at the supposedly living ones and possibly hitting dead ones or accepting the risk that the living ones start fighting from better position (possibly from between their friends)

Now, problems 1 and 3 are mostly caused by laziness, tiredness, impoliteness and disregard for other players, and can be cured by more information and stricter rules. Not sure if worth it, since that would propably mean less effort put into other stuff.

Problem 2 could be cured with easily available dead rags of the right colour and/or stricter control of rag colour. Proper orange cloth wouldn't cost much in large amounts, so maybe worth looking into? Oh, and maybe you could get someone to sponsor dead rags with advertisement on them?
